In 2024, Globe Theatre's 'Romeo and Juliet': youth passion amid escalating gang violence.
Witness a dynamic rendition of "Playing Shakespeare with Deutsche Bank: Romeo and Juliet" at the Globe Theatre, a 90-minute adaptation set in 2024 that vividly portrays the intense love between the titular characters against a backdrop of rising violence between rival gangs, directed by Lucy Cuthbertson, the Globe’s Director of Education, offering a compelling introduction to Shakespeare for young audiences by exploring the impact of a fractured society on the lives of its youth.
